データとデータの移行を復元します(個人的なメモ、無用リーダー)

使用 xtrabackup データを回復するために行う、に戻っポンプの数 ビッグデータプラットフォームHDFS 使用しての外観を作成するために、ハイブのために。
 
zichan.tar.gz(ディレクトリ)を取得します。内部は圧縮されたパッケージです。
    
#解凍子産。タール.gzを
 タール zvxfi XXXXX。タール.gzの
#は、バックアップディレクトリの子産、および子産を作成します。タール.gzを同じディレクトリ。
MKDIR 子産
#はXXXXX。うtarはバックアップディレクトリに.gzmv。
MV XXXXX。タール .gzを../zichan/ 
#(自分のパス上の実際の状況を変更する)、自分自身の完了後に、参照データ復元コマンドをOKを完了!成功するでしょう。
/ opt / Percona-xtrabackup- 2.414 -linux-x86_64版/ binに/ innobackupex --defaults ファイル =を/ mnt / DISK1 /子産。タール .gzを/バックログ--- my.cnfファイルを適用するの/ mnt / disk1に/ 。子産タール .gzを/ 
ディレクトリ#の削除しないでください解凍の内側部分
RMを -RF MySQLの
 RMを - RFのINFORMATION_SCHEMAの
 RM - テストRF 
#mvとは、ローカルのMySQLのデータベースのデータディレクトリにファイルを。(CPファイルは、遅すぎる、大きすぎる)
MVを/ mnt / DISK1 /子産。タール .gzを/子産*を/ mnt / disk1に/ mysqlの/データ/ 
#が子産ます。タールディレクトリ.gzをCP内のすべてのファイルのローカルのMySQLへデータディレクトリ。あなたは、データに直接「Y」と同じファイルをカバーするように求められます。
CPは/ mnt / disk1に/子産。タール .gzを/ * を/ mnt / disk1の/ MySQLの/データ/ 
ビュー#は、ファイルパス内のユーザーやユーザーグループのデータを変更します。
-R mysqlのはchown:mysqlの./ 
#再起動のMySQL、MySQLデータベースのMVにログインすることができ、この時間は、すべての(子産***)上で見ました。
開始MySQLサーバの
#は(HDFSに対するMySQL)①いくつかの段階を描きます。Javaのjarファイルとconf.propertiesは、このjarは数字を描かれているパスを変更します。
#あるRevise 1、mysqlのどこIP
#2は、変更あなたが抽出するMySQLデータベースを修正します。
#3修正、スレッドの数は、それを変更することはできません。修正とコードは関連しますか?またはパフォーマンス関連のノード?コードはまだ見ていません。
ポンピングステージ②の#数、JARパッケージを実行します。
Javaの-jar xxxx.jar&nohupは
#は、実行中のプロセスと結果を表示します。すべてのスレッドの終わりが完了したとき。nohup.out(nohupをログ)の完了後に削除することができ
nohup.outテール-f 
だけのJavaプロセスの実行中の末尾から、#最後のステップ。
ps -ef | grepのジャーパッケージのjarパッケージキーワードまたは
殺す-9プロセスID
 

おすすめ

転載: www.cnblogs.com/singsong-ss/p/10986193.html